Minutes, November 20, 2016

The Middle East Sociology Working Group met for brunch at Globe Restaurant near the Middle East Studies Association’s conference site in Boston, Massachusetts, on November 20, 2016. The meeting was scheduled on the final day of the conference so as not to conflict with a midday panel the previous day, “No Going Back: The Road to Gender Transformation in the Arab World.” Unfortunately, meeting at the end of the conference may have accounted for a slightly reduced turnout. Nonetheless, we welcomed several new members to our group and had a series of lively conversations.

Our petition drive for a Global Middle East section at the American Sociological Association remains about 30 signatories short of the ASA’s threshold of 200.

In other news, our cadre is growing enough that a publisher has inquired about authors interested in producing a textbook on Middle East Sociology. If you are interested, please get in touch with me at kurzman@unc.edu.
